Given the many substantiated concerns regarding SETs, it is recommended that end-term course evaluation ratings be considered as one of many pieces of data used to evaluate teaching effectiveness. Research has identified other useful forms of data and feedback, such as mid-term feedback, reflective teaching portfolios, and peer evaluations.

Summative assessments are given to students at the end of a course and should measure the skills and knowledge a student has gained over the entire instructional period. False Working while in school lowers …Appropriate Multiple-Choice Tests Can Foster Test-Induced Learning. One of the criticisms of multiple-choice tests is that they expose test takers to the correct answer among the available options. Our aim with this review was to describe the most prominent models …Formal feedback is typically given on a set schedule and is much more involved, such as an annual review. Informal feedback tends to be brief and is usually given shortly following an action or event. “It may be more random, like a quick aside in the hallway or a response sent via email,” explains Bailey. Summative feedback is aimed at helping students understand how well they have done in meeting the overall learning goals of the course. Effective summative assessments They should align with the course learning goals and build upon prior formative assessments.
